I have had a steady light on for awhile, then when cold, I would have a serious engine shutter, feels like a mis-fire and then flashing code light. I got a scan and came up with P430, P303, P1320. Sounds like a mis-fire on cylinder #3, along with an "Ignition signal primary" 85K miles, I plan to change spark plugs, injector cleaner too?? What do you guys think? Any help would be appreciated!

I am not totaly familliar with the infinity line but this should be basicaly the same as the PF it calls for spark plugs at 105k miles. Yours is a little under that but given the years and if a lot of city driving not uncommon. If you do a lot of local driving in short spurts and live in a cold climate then you may want to change to the hotter plugs. These engines are not cheap for tune-ups so be prepaired!!

The 1320 code is for a coil. If it says Cyl. 3, replace your cyl.3 coil. Also, if you have 85k miles on your QX4, I would def. change your spark plugs too.
The P0430 code is for the catalytic converter.
If I were to assume, you have let this go for a while. Chances are you have a dead coil which is running very rich in that dead cylinder which has your cat. tore up. Replace coil, change plugs, and drive it hard for a little bit, maybe the cat will "clean out". Then try clearing the codes.
I appreciate the replies! Why would the "mis-fire" symptoms only happen when cold, and then disapear after it has run for a while? Also, what imputs into the computer would trigger a mis-fire?
